Repair insights: bring in the matching color plastic repair compound with the enclosed plastic spatula into the damaged area. Select an appropriate structure paper for the surface to be repaired, top it onto the repaired area, and finish it with the included dry heat transfer stamp - and you are DONE.

The plastic repair material remains flexible and resilient as leather after drying for synthetic leather, vinyl, soft plastic, for hard plastic add on the powdered hardener supplied within. The surface structure paper must be chosen accordingly. The plastic repair materials are mixable and can be individually matched to the color of the surface to be repaired using the attached color mixing table. Featured Solution For Professionals 3M professional automotive adhesives can be used by collision repair technicians or auto customizers in areas where high strength bonds are required, and have been designed by 3M to suit a wide range of automotive applications, work times, sand times, and cure times. Automotive adhesives can be epoxy or urethane based, flexible or rigid. Several adhesives are available with corrosion inhibitors or with an ability to featheredge and fill, and some can adhere to wood, rubber, glass, metal, SMC, fiberglass, and across a range of plastics depending on use.

In addition, 3M manufactures cyanoacrylates, adhesion promoters and patches, auto glass primers and auto glass adhesives, along with a range of manual and pneumatic applicators and automotive adhesive mixing systems. Two part epoxy adhesives are designed with a range of work times that can be rapidly cured with heat. Where manufacturer directions are followed, 3M™ Panel Bonding Adhesive is an automotive epoxy that can be used to replace welds in non-structural areas such as bonding door skins, roof skins, quarter panels and box sides. In applications where both a filler and an adhesive is needed, such as cosmetic repair or installations in SMC, FRP (traditional fiberglass) or rigid plastic automotive parts, 3M™ Rigid Parts Repair Adhesive is recommended.

For the most flexible plastic parts, such as bumper covers or other plastic automotive panels, 3M recommends the 3M™ EZ Sand Flexible Parts Repair Adhesive, which is formulated to deliver an excellent feather edge and can be used in conjunction with an automotive adhesive patch per relevant 3M standard operating procedures for your repair. Urethane automotive adhesives can be used as general purpose adhesives across a equally wide range of materials, or in specific applications where fast cure times in a variety of temperatures is required. For example, 3M™ SMC and Fiberglass Repair Adhesive is formulated with work times from 90 seconds to 35 minutes, so technicians can select the right adhesive for the job—whether that is quickly bonding backup strips to fiberglass or bonding fiberglass parts to primed metal frames. Semi-rigid urethane adhesives like 3M™ Super Fast Repair Adhesive are part of 3M standard operating procedures for bumper tab repair or eyelet repair, while 3M™ Universal Adhesive gives a tough and flexible bond for plastic add-on parts such as spoilers, flares, air dams, impact strips, emblems and other automotive ground effects parts.

3M automotive glass adhesives are one part moisture curing urethanes, and are designed for applications in windshield bonding and stationary glass attachment. 3M Auto Adhesive for OEM and Tier Suppliers 3M offers a wide selection of structural and non-structural strength adhesives, tapes and innovative dispensing systems for use in automotive OEM manufacturing and tier supplier processes.
